Output 0e68325d291f559ebdae32663e574b78444f7d26a895ec5edffe61dfa5fecd0e:3

value
434117
script pubkey
OP_0 OP_PUSHBYTES_20 245c0866b7bcba61ef7695bdda62246ac73cdc25
address
tb1qy3wqse4hhjaxrmmkjk7a5c3ydtrnehp9ygwkc0
transaction
0e68325d291f559ebdae32663e574b78444f7d26a895ec5edffe61dfa5fecd0e
spent
false